Cost of Living Comparison Between Copenhagen and Randers Cost of Living Comparison Between Copenhagen and Randers

Monthly Cost of Living

A single person spends $3,028 per month in Copenhagen vs $2,073 in Randers, rent included.

A couple spends around $4,732 per month in Copenhagen vs $3,138 in Randers, rent included.

A family of three spends $6,435 per month in Copenhagen vs $4,202 in Randers, rent included.

Copenhagen costs about 46% more than Randers, driven mainly by Eating Out.

Both Copenhagen and Randers sit above the global median – Copenhagen by 126%, Randers by 55%.

Cost Breakdown

A central one-bedroom costs $2,014 in Copenhagen versus $767 in Randers. Rent is usually the largest line item in a monthly budget, so the gap here sets the tone for the overall comparison.

Salaries run about 40% higher in Copenhagen, which partly offsets the higher cost of living there. Purchasing power depends on which expenses matter most to you.

A mid-range dinner for two costs $126 in Copenhagen versus $95.0 in Randers. Monthly groceries follow the same trend: $424 vs $366 – making Randers the more affordable choice for daily food spending.
